    Good things come out of Nazareth terrorist attack

    In follow-up to this earlier story about three people who went into the Church of the Annunciation in Nazareth with firecrackers and tear gas:

    Israelis Apologize for Blasts in Basilica
    Church Leaders Thankful for Moves to Defend Nazareth Site


    Some good things occurred after the attack:

    The incident drew thousands of people representing various religious from Nazareth and surrounding villages to the basilica with the intention of protecting it. The crowd remained late into the night.

    That same night, Israeli authorities formally apologized to Archbishop Giovanni Lajolo, Vatican secretary for relations with states, to Latin Patriarch Michel Sabbah of Jerusalem, and to Father Pierbattista Pizzaballa, the Custos of the Holy Land.

    [The Latin Patriarchate responded] "We thank the entire crowd, from different religious backgrounds, who came yesterday to defend our holy places and the Basilica of the Annunciation in Nazareth. "In this we see an awareness to strengthen the unity of the people and an effort to avoid such incidents before they happen."
